Output f7661c1351d134e750203580ebe9e712ffa956c8a51f815e21d9ab3fc3759833:1

value
3224137058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7caaa1f8b111052815c8f98ddd243df1a0c6515 OP_EQUAL
address
3NpcoEdyvu5boM8WpeArY5NN2Gry7F5dGx
transaction
f7661c1351d134e750203580ebe9e712ffa956c8a51f815e21d9ab3fc3759833
confirmations
369034
spent
true